The Kia EV3 battery sits comfortably in the upper-midrange for similar-sized electric cars. Its real-world range exceeds many competitors, thanks to improved thermal regulation and software optimization—offering more usable distance with less degradation over time.

Many assume larger batteries mean harsher weight or shorter driving ranges—but the EV3’s design counters this by balancing capacity with lightweight engineering and smart thermal control. Battery longevity is also misunderstood: while all lithium-ion packs degrade over time, the EV3’s thermal system and software optimizations reduce stress, making long-term efficiency more reliable than average. Additionally, range claims are consistently backed by official reports, avoiding misleading marketing tactics.

At its core, the Kia EV3’s battery leverages lithium-ion technology with careful thermal management and smart energy distribution. The pack holds approximately 64 kilowatt-hours (kWh) of storage—enough to deliver an EPA-estimated range of around 250 to 280 miles on a full charge, depending on driving conditions. This capacity balances longevity, quick rechargeability, and practical daily commuting and weekend trip ranges.

Charging efficiency is another strength: standard home Level 2 charging replenishes around 100 miles in 30 minutes, while DC fast charging delivers substantial range gains in about 20 minutes. These features, paired with regenerative braking that recovers energy during deceleration, ensure every charge feels purposeful and convenient—even for long-distance travel.
